At 6 weeks old, little Lottie Leurentop might not remember her visit with Santa Claus on Sunday at South Coast Plaza. But her parents will.

A photo and maybe a few minutes going over wishlists with Santa is a tradition for so many families, and plenty of them have been squeezing in visits with the big guy at Orange County’s malls ahead of Christmas Day.

South Coast Plaza has two elaborately decorated Santa experiences, one in the Carousel Court in the main section of the mall and one across Bear Street in the Macy’s Home Store Wing.

He’ll be in residence through Christmas Eve at several of the area’s shopping centers — we don’t ask questions about how that is possible, just be sure to check local websites for times and more information.
